Immunogen
Synthetic peptide (aa 1-16) of abeta peptides 38, 40, 42 coupled to key-hole limpet hemocyanin via an added C-terminal cysteine residue. Epitope aa 4-8
WB: 1:500 up to 1:1000 (ECL detection), ICC: 1:500, IHC: 1:500 up to 1:1000, ,

Rekonstitution
For reconstitution add 100µl H2O to get a 1mg/ml solution in PBS.
Buffer
PBS. Azide was added before lyophilization.
